Transaction 666a4e1190fae2ef3707040afd72a2735297d9e3fe0904576f868807de0a3f36

2 Input
1 Outputs
  • 666a4e1190fae2ef3707040afd72a2735297d9e3fe0904576f868807de0a3f36:0
  • value  2441109
    address  1BRLDY2pCyoTBKMVLDTfkBFJbESRp4co5s